Update - Neoadjuvant treatment of Herceptin and Tykerb
I completed my Herceptin/Tykerb treatment at the end of June and had my surgery July 3rd. The cancer was not completely cleared as I had hoped but all that remained of that very large tumor (>7 cm) were two small nodules less than .8 cm each. I had 27 lymph nodes removed and only 4 of those still had cancer. It's difficult to depict how many lymph nodes were originally malignant from the MRI, but more than likely I had a lot more than 4 when I started. The important thing is that I had good clear margins. I start AC on August 16.
Overall, my reponse was great compared to where I started from.
Stage IIIb/with IBC
grade 3 tumor
negative ER/PR
> 7 cm
Her2++ (I think ratio was 11.8)
